5 Creative and Funny Business Ideas from the Best Indonesian Companies

Indonesia is known for its vibrant culture, breathtaking landscapes, and delicious cuisine. But did you know that the country is also home to some of the most innovative and successful companies in the world? In this blog post, we will explore five creative and funny business ideas from the best Indonesian companies that have captured the hearts of consumers both locally and globally. 1. Go-Jek: Go-Jek is a technology company that provides a wide range of services, including transportation, food delivery, and payment solutions. One of the most creative initiatives by Go-Jek is their "Go-Box" service, where customers can request a truck to help them move items such as furniture or appliances. To add a touch of fun to their services, Go-Jek introduced a feature where customers can request for a truck decorated with colorful balloons and streamers, making the moving experience more enjoyable and memorable. 2. Tokopedia: Tokopedia is an e-commerce platform that allows individuals and small businesses to sell products online. To stand out from competitors, Tokopedia launched a campaign called "Jualan Aja" which translates to "Just Sell." The campaign features humorous commercials showing everyday people selling unusual items such as their mother-in-law's annoying laugh or a broken heart. This creative approach not only generated buzz but also increased brand awareness and engagement among consumers. 3. Warung Pintar: Warung Pintar is a micro-retail startup that transforms traditional "warungs" or small shops into smart, tech-enabled stores. To attract customers and create a fun shopping experience, Warung Pintar partnered with local artists to decorate their stores with colorful murals and graffiti. This initiative not only supports the local art community but also reinforces the company's commitment to innovation and creativity. 4. Traveloka: Traveloka is a leading online travel agency that offers a wide range of travel services, including flights, hotels, and activities. To spice up their marketing efforts, Traveloka launched a series of humorous commercials featuring a quirky spokesperson named "Pak Presiden" (Mr. President) who provides travel tips and advice in a comedic manner. The videos went viral on social media, showcasing Traveloka's playful and relatable brand personality. 5. Kitabisa: Kitabisa is Indonesia's largest crowdfunding platform that connects individuals and organizations with charitable causes. To engage donors and raise awareness for important social issues, Kitabisa introduced a feature called "Donasi Sambil Nonton" (Donate While Watching) where users can contribute to fundraising campaigns while streaming their favorite movies or TV shows. This creative idea not only encourages donations but also makes the fundraising process more entertaining and interactive. In conclusion, these Indonesian companies have demonstrated that creativity and humor can be powerful tools in business planning and marketing strategies. By thinking outside the box and injecting a dose of fun into their offerings, these companies have not only differentiated themselves from competitors but also built strong connections with their target audience. As the business landscape continues to evolve, embracing creativity and humor could be the key to success for companies looking to make a lasting impact in the market.
